One can take the basic exam upon completing an undergraduate degree. This exam covers almost everything learned during university, such as advanced mathematics, physics, organic/inorganic chemistry, electrical engineering, principles of chemical engineering, and so on. For reference, one can use the two-volume book \"Review Guide for the Basic Exam of the Registration Examination for Chemical Engineers\" published by Tianjin University Press. After passing the basic exam, and five years after graduating from undergraduate studies or three years after graduating from graduate studies, one can take the specialized exam. The core subject is generally Principles of Chemical Engineering, but the questions are very practical, making the subject quite difficult to pass. No authoritative exam preparation materials are available on the market.
